Evolving the National Reporting System

After five years of hard work, USDA’s National Institute of Food and Agriculture (USDA-NIFA) launched the integrated National Reporting System (NRS) last year. 

The new system offers significant improvements, but user feedback made clear that additional features were needed. New features have been added—building on a successful system that’s already improving data collection and reducing our partners’ reporting burden.

Improvements—Mission Critical

One of NIFA’s 2022 goals is to continue technology modernization efforts across the agency to provide the best customer service and user experience. The improvements to the NRS represent one way we are working to achieve that goal. Additionally, they are part of USDA’s larger commitment to see the agency become a data-driven and customer experience-centered organization.

Key Upgrades

  • Users can submit results for capacity-funded research projects and Extension programs in NRS.
  • Users can now add, edit, view and submit results for approval within NRS.
  • Email notifications will alert users to important changes in project/program status.
  • Users can filter and search by Knowledge Area to more easily find projects/programs pertaining to a specific subject matter.
  • Overall system and design improvements include a new, reorganized design to the project view and more intuitive button features.
